Risk and Control – Control Testing Associate
The Control function is responsible for managing and ensuring a sustainable governance framework to ensure controls are ‘fit for purpose’, operating as designed and are adaptable to the challenges brought in by various external events and regulatory changes. The team thus looks to facilitate identification of the firm’s risks by ensuring adequate controls are in place within Operations.

Key responsibilities include (but not limited to) the following:
Primary Responsibility
- Control Testing & Validation: Execute comprehensive operating effectiveness testing on pre-identified controls across business processes, ensuring controls are functioning as designed and meeting regulatory and internal risk management standards
Supporting Responsibilities
- Test Planning & Execution: Develop detailed test plans, select appropriate sample sizes, and perform walkthroughs to validate implementation effectiveness
- Documentation & Evidence Gathering: Collect, review, and analyze supporting documentation to substantiate control performance, maintaining detailed workpapers and audit trails
- Issue Identification & Reporting: Identify control deficiencies, gaps, or failures; document findings with clear root cause analysis and communicate results to management and stakeholders
- Risk Assessment Support: Collaborate with risk management teams to assess the impact of control weaknesses and contribute to overall risk profile evaluations
- Remediation Tracking: Monitor and track management action plans for identified control deficiencies, ensuring timely resolution and re-testing of remediated controls
- Regulatory Compliance: Ensure testing procedures align with applicable regulatory requirements and internal governance frameworks
- Process Improvement: Recommend enhancements to control design and testing methodologies based on observations and industry best practices
- Stakeholder Communication: Present testing results and findings to business unit managers and internal audit teams through clear, concise reporting
- Data Analysis: Utilize data analytics tools and techniques to identify trends, anomalies, and potential control weaknesses across large datasets
- Cross-functional Collaboration: Work closely with business process owners, internal audit, compliance, and external auditors to coordinate testing activities and share insights
